Palembang songket weaving
That said, weaving in the region of Palembang has existed since ancient kingdom of Srivijaya. 
Manufacturing technology is not actually originate in the area, but from China, India, and Arab. The existence of trade between nations with the Kingdom of Srivijaya, which in turn leads to acculturation. And, one of the cultural elements absorbed Palembang society is in terms of making woven fabric.
Palembang songket weaving is widely used by women in traditional wedding ceremony, both the bride, female dancers, and female guests who attend. 
In addition, songket is also used in an official ceremony welcoming officials from outside or from Palembang itself.
Palembang songket motifs generally consist of three parts, the motif of plants (especially the form of stylized flowers), geometric motifs, and a mixture of herbs is also geometric. 
Motifs are passed from generation to generation so that the pattern has not changed. Some names Palembang songket motifs include: Lepus piham, Lepus plain, Bunge rose, melon seeds, jando ornate, Tigo country, heart of gold,:
Today, not only produced as songket sarong or cloth, but also has produced all kinds of other products. 
Examples such as drawing walls, tablecloths, rugs, clothing women, sheets, scarves, handkerchiefs, and others.
Tapis cloth
Fabric filter is in the form of Lampung tribe of women's clothing sarong made from cotton yarn woven with diverse motives, such as the motif of nature, flora, and fauna that are embroidered (front line system) with gold and silver thread. 
Weave is usually used on the waist down. According to Van der Hoop, since the second century AD, the people of Lampung has been weaving brocade and cloth called Pelepai tray. Both of these results has woven motifs such as motif hooks and female friend, trees and buildings that contain the life of the human spirit that has died, animals, sun, moon, and jasmine. After passing the time span is long enough, eventually born Lampung cloth filter. Lampung people continue to develop the fabric filter in accordance with the times in terms of both manufacturing techniques and motives.
This type of filter cloth variety, can be viewed by region of origin or according to the wearer. 
By region of origin, some types of fabric filters are as follows: from the Coastal region, such as filters Inuh, Cucuk Andak, Semaka, Yellow, Cukkil, and Jinggu; of Way Kanan River area, such as filters Jung Sarat, Balak, shoots Bamboo shoots, Halom / Gabo, Glass, Lawok Halam, Tuha, King Medal, and Lawok Silung. While the example filter according to its use include: Jung Sarat filter, commonly used in the bride's traditional marriage ceremony; King Single filter, worn by the wife of the oldest relatives (tuho penyimbang) on ​​traditional marriage ceremony and taking the title, both titles prince and sovereign; Medal King filter, normally used by the wife of the oldest family in traditional ceremonies, such as ceremonies and taking his son to marry a prince; filter Andak Sea, commonly worn by the girl at the customs cangget dancers, and others. These are some examples of the types of filters according to the wearer.
Ulos Batak
Ulos fabric typical of Lake Toba is one of the Batak traditional handicrafts are very famous. 
Fabric is usually woven with gold and silver is predominantly red, black, and white. First, the cloth is only used as a shawl and sarong kebaya for the couple. However, at this time has been modified so often used in products that are more attractive and economically valuable, such as pillow cases, bags, clothes, and others.
For the Batak, ulos not only used for daily wear, but also for traditional ceremonies. 
The use of fabric, there are three ways, namely by siabithononton (used), sihadanghononton (wrapped around the head / carry), sitalitalihononton (wrapped around the waist). However, not all types of ulos can be used in daily activities.Aside from being a protector of the body, it also serves a symbolic ulos. Ulos of certain types of fabric believed to contain magical power and is considered sacred and has the magical power to protect the wearer.
There are various types ulos, among them: maratur star, ragiidup, sibolang, ragihotang, Mangiring, dansadum. 
Various types mempuyai Ulos the level of complexity, value, and different functions. The more complicated the creation of a Ulos, then the higher value and the price is also more expensive. Reportedly, at this time, most of the Batak ulos almost extinct, as has been discontinued, as ulos king, yeast botik, sombre, saput (ulos used as wrapping the corpse), and ulos sibolang.

Weaving Troso
Troso is the name of one of the villages in the district Pecangaan, Jepara regency. 
In this village, troso weaving community activism.Actually, the technique of weaving looms troso gedok and in the long term evolve into ikat. This weaving craft that developed since the Dutch era has about 50 unique patterns that kept Troso authenticity, such as warp ikat patterns, fish feed, and striated. In addition to these motifs, some weaving Troso also said that many who adopt the style shades Troso other areas, such as the primitive style of Sumbawa and Kalimantan.
In Jepara, weaving Troso an official uniform civil servants and employees of enterprises every Thursday - Saturday. 
However, after the introduction of five working days, weaving Troso used as a uniform on Thursday and Friday.
Bedouin weaving
If you examine the first acid in the Bedouin tradition of weaving, of course, be related to the history of the society itself. 
According Anisjatisunda, the old Sundanese culture examines Bedouin, Bedouin weaving has existed since the community was settled in behind Mount Kendeng (Kanekes area now). To satisfy his need for clothing, Bedouin communities in the days of empire Padjajaran, utilizing the existing natural potential. At that time, the natural resources in the form of cotton is the most easily obtainable. Thus, there is processed into cotton cloth with a simple spinning, then by means of the woven wood and bamboo around it.
The white color is the dominant color in addition to the black Bedouin weaving, is the earliest color used by the Bedouin community. 
The white color is not colored because it uses the original color of white cotton. This white color means bright, clean, or represented as Hyang who have no form. For the black Bedouin weaving, is the hallmark of which is owned by foreign Baduy. The black color here implies a dark or night. In the context of the Bedouin, this color will be the patron behind the light.
Bedouin weaving is in addition very ogled because keeksotisannya local designers, were reportedly also been entered into overseas markets, namely Europe and the Middle East.

Weaving Gringsing
Also called Wastra gringsing made from cotton yarn with a variety of motifs formed from double ikat (tie yarns and weft lungsi once). 
It is said that this kind of double weave is very rare, only available in Japan as well as India, other than Indonesia. Making takes a long time, ranging from one to five years, and be done with a difficult technique. Later, the weaving gringsing will form the pattern matching geomteris neat and beautiful.
Wastra gringsing woven by the village of Tenganan Pagringsingan.However, the process of indigo dyeing and brown it done in other villages. 
Because it is considered taboo if it is done in the same village. Therefore, the process of indigo dyeing is usually carried out in the village of Bug-bug and red-brown color made in the village of Nusa Penida.
Motives are often used in weaving Gringsing very typical, among other motifs taken from Puppet Bah Mahabaratha story. 
Woven with a pattern is often used in dance and Rejang Abuang in sacred rituals by both men and women. Outside the village of Tenganan, gringsing cloth worn under his head in gear-cutting ceremony is a ceremony or mepandes metatah. The fabric is also used in ceremonies menek Daha (ceremonies marking puberty) and pemapah bride in the marriage ceremony. By a shaman or healer, gringsing fabric used to treat the sick by covering the body or diseased parts of the patient. In addition, gringsing fabric is also used to decorate temples, shrines, and towers in the cremation ceremony.
Weaving Endek
Endek woven ikat technique with decorative improvements in certain parts of the fabric by adding coletan called nyantri. 
Nyantri is the addition of color with brush strokes of the bamboo like a painting. Nyantrinya diverse motives, such as flora, fauna, as well as motifs taken from Balinese mythology and puppets. Weaving is also a lot endek given a combination of gold thread songket or silver ornaments found on the edge of the fabric.
Endek weaving can be found in two common forms. 
The first form sheath and used by men. Endek sarong has a connection in the middle or side. The second form of long cloth used by women. This fabric has a motif at the edges while the middle plain.
Endek often used as a custom clothing, and the demand by various levels of society. 
In addition to the traditional clothes, woven endek can also be found on the man's shirt, dress, or material of a residential interior design decoration.

Sasak weaving
Sade village is a center of production of the famous woven Sasak Lombok. 
The women do the weaving in the old ways, ranging from the manufacture of yarn using natural ingredients such as pineapple fiber, banana fiber, cotton, bark; also in terms of coloring the use of natural materials, such as the yellow color of turmeric, brown bark, red from betel leaves, and purple from indigo.
According to one of the village artisans weaving sasak Sukarara, Central Lombok, weaving motif sasak more than 150 species, both native motifs of earlier craftsmen and artisans development of the next result. 
For woven Sasak motifs include the results of the creative process is subahnale palm flowers, subahnale bali, month brackets and remawe star.
Weaving Bayan
Weaving of different kinds of styles can also be found in Bayan district, North Lombok. 
In this area, woven with specific patterns even must be owned by indigenous people. For example, woven fabrics such as londong brother (red cloth) shall be used when attending rituals, such as maulidan, widths, and the Koran's tomb.
Bayan weaving quite complex and difficult. 
All of the manufacturing process uses wood and bamboo tools are manually operated.Search time can be up to two weeks. In this process though may be similar to that found in other places, but the difference between the outer fabric woven with Bayan Bayan is any pattern created describing the wearer from a particular village huts or in the Bayan.
